How old do you have to be to rent a car in Servas?
Drivers 21 and over can road trip around Servas in a rental vehicle. If you're a young renter, a daily surcharge applies. You'll generally be limited to a few car categories, such as compact and mid-size, and may also be required to purchase an all-inclusive insurance rate. Always enter the correct age of the main driver when booking to learn if any surcharges or restrictions apply.
What do you need to rent a car in Servas?
The essentials are your driver's licence and a credit card in the same name. Car rental companies will offer you insurance, which is optional. But you may have to provide proof of alternative coverage if you opt out. We recommend checking your policy terms and conditions to avoid any hassles.
What side of the road do you drive on in Servas?
Drivers from the U.S. will feel quite at home cruising around Servas — motorists here drive on the right.
